What Santa Rosa Beach specifically changes

Santa Rosa Beach’s specific building codes and coastal environmental factors influence our master keying strategies. Corrosion-resistant hardware is essential due to the salty air. We ensure compliance with local regulations while implementing systems that withstand the coastal climate, adapting to the area’s distinct needs.

The common mistake

Many opt for cheap, generic master key systems that fail to account for future expansions or changes in staff/access needs. This oversight leads to costly rekeying down the line. A common mistake is prioritizing initial cost savings over long-term flexibility and security.

Hardware tier vs price tier

Don’t confuse hardware quality with the service’s price tier. High-grade locks (e.g., stainless steel, weather-tight) might be paired with a standard master keying service. We transparently differentiate between hardware upgrades and the master keying process itself to meet your budget and security requirements.
